Ev. {Ivan Evernden - coachwork} 8/JH.22.4.40. Revised Front Pivot - Senior Range. On PL.167 herewith we show the finished design of the Buick type front pivot for the Senior range of car. The scheme also includes the reduced out of centre point already experimentally incorporated on the old design. The wheels for both 5" and 4 1/2" rims remain unaltered. The brake drums both heavy and light type are unaltered except for the addition of the thin back plate which has already been detailed. The new design with solid stub should have a diameter of 1.425 to have equal strength with the previous hollow stub. Our design has a diameter of 1.406 and we feel justified in saying that we have created no real loss in strength. This scheme shows the cross steering lever and modifications to the ball joint for cars having the standard ground clearance. BY. {R.W.
